The Bosch Rexroth Indramat SF-A5.0250.030-10.067 is part of the SF Servo Motors series and features a rated speed of 3000 min-1 with a locked-rotor torque of 23 Nm. Its construction type is IM B5, and it has a flange diameter of 190 mm and a centering diameter of ⌀180 j6. The motor is equipped with windings thermistors for thermal protection and has an encoder resolution of 8 million increments per revolution.

Product Description:

The SF-A5.0250.030-10.067 is a servo motor supplied by Bosch Rexroth Indramat within the SF Servo Motors series. It functions as the mechanical output stage of a drive system, converting regulated current from a matching controller into controlled rotary motion for conveyors, pick-and-place heads, or indexing tables. By pairing rare-earth magnets with high-accuracy feedback, the unit delivers repetitive positioning without incremental drift, making it suitable for automated packaging, material handling, and light machining cells where repeatable speed and torque are required. The feedback arrangement also lets the controller correct position and speed during closed-loop operation.

The motor mounts through an IM B5 flange whose face measures 190 mm, while the pilot fits a centering seat of Ø180 j6 to support coaxial alignment with the driven machine. This mounting arrangement helps keep the shaft centered during installation and reduces coupling misalignment. The winding produces a continuous torque constant of 1.44 Nm/A, so the drive can relate shaft torque to phase current during operation. Under locked-rotor conditions, the shaft develops 23 Nm, indicating starting capability against static loads. During rated operation, the rotor reaches 3000 rpm, a speed suited to common transmission ratios in servo gearboxes.

Closed-loop feedback is delivered by an optical encoder that records 8 million increments per revolution and maintains absolute position within ±20 arcseconds. This resolution supports fine speed regulation and small position corrections during repeated cycles. A 1.25-size circular connector carries power through a 4 x 4.0 mm² cable, and the selected construction type keeps the stator sealed against coolant or oil splash encountered in inline production modules. Starting current peaks at 16 A when the rotor is held, so the drive must accommodate the associated thermal surge, while winding thermistors relay real-time temperature to help protect the insulation system. The assembly withstands shocks up to 6 g, allowing installation on moving gantries or press feeders.
